Job overview
The Fair Hearings Specialist 1 Spanish Language role involves managing administrative hearing processes and providing information and support to clients and agency staff, impacting fair hearing operations within the NYS Office of Temporary & Disability Assistance.
Responsibilities and impact
The specialist will handle hearing scheduling, process hearing requests, provide information on procedures, manage hearing workflows, respond to inquiries, draft correspondence, screen emergency hearings, update relevant systems, and assist supervisors with procedures and reports.
Experience and skills
Candidates need four years of paraprofessional or professional experience in social services or related programs, with college education or legal assistant qualifications substituting for experience; Spanish proficiency is required for communication and translation duties.

Unique job features
The position is part of the NY HELPS program allowing non-competitive appointment with future conversion to competitive status, and requires Spanish language proficiency to serve Spanish-speaking clients effectively.
Company overview
The New York State Office of Temporary and Disability Assistance (OTDA) is a government agency responsible for overseeing programs that provide temporary financial assistance and support to eligible New Yorkers. They manage initiatives like the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P),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F), and the Home Energy Assistance Program (HEAP), among others. The agency's primary goal is to enhance the economic security and well-being of individuals and families in need. OTDA generates revenue through state and federal funding, which is allocated to support its various programs and services.
